Output 2366c108127df38c610fd9cc5e4f10871379cb05463f7750d5e43834d4572f06:128

value
1152705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ca4ae8ceaafb7457bf42f3dd12f1eaeb9623e11 OP_EQUAL
address
3EWfohFCpqumhtG2m58HEtfzbMM7n4he4T
transaction
2366c108127df38c610fd9cc5e4f10871379cb05463f7750d5e43834d4572f06